Output e424a9ba24ee878220db760202cc22029c9fd4e1fc1ffa81f667670f29e07b39:3

value
995462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d7244839ed6382c3bfa01248590ed2cc8c2efed OP_EQUALVERIFY OP_CHECKSIG
address
1FMVyaAJSzeXUCNC1rmuatSJ8wkWzdSUws
transaction
e424a9ba24ee878220db760202cc22029c9fd4e1fc1ffa81f667670f29e07b39
spent
true